General Description
The Political Director will expand the impact of Justice Democrats, helping our candidates win their elections and driving forward our legislative and communications priorities. This is a critical role in the organization, requiring high level communication and relationship building skills and the savvy to navigate a complex political environment. A successful applicant will have the proven ability to mobilize organizations, coalitions, candidates and elected officials to execute bold and strategic interventions.
This role reports to the Executive Director.
Essential Duties & Responsibilities
Develop strategies and work plans to advance our legislative and communications priorities in Congress
Work with senior leadership on communications projects that advance the policy and political goals of the organization
Work with senior leadership to drive JD’s electoral goals for the 2020 and 2022 cycles
Build relationships with key allies, coalitions, organizations, candidates, and elected officials
Provide strategic advice to senior leadership on evolving political dynamics and strategies for achieving JD’s mission
Establish ways of tracking metrics of success, and work with relevant staff across the organization to adopt lessons learned
Represent JD to a wide variety of political stakeholders
Preferred Qualifications
We are looking for an exceptional candidate that fits our mission and our way of working. Below are some of the qualifications we are looking for in an applicant. We welcome any and all applicants who can get the job done, regardless of previous experience.
Strong political network and relationships among progressive leaders and organizations, including in Congress
Experience with candidate endorsement processes
Ability to mobilize allies in issue-based and electoral coalitions
Excellent political analysis and communications skills, written and verbal
Familiarity with political news media
Familiarity with Congressional legislative process
Ability to work both independently, and as part of a collaborative leadership team
This is a full-time staff role. The compensation for this position is $75,000 per year, plus full benefits.
This position will be based in Washington, DC. All duties can be conducted virtually during the COVID-19 pandemic, so there is no immediate need for relocation.
